Mikati meets with economic bodies’ delegation, chairs meeting over ration card

Prime Minister, Najib Mikati, on Monday underlined that cooperation of all parties is very important to put Lebanon on the path of recovery, indicating that “the first step we’re working on is to stop the collapse happening in the country and to end the urgent problems related to securing the electricity power and resolving the medicine and fuel crisis, in parallel with the transition to address other problems in cooperation with the relevant international bodies.”

Premier Mikati welcomed at the Grand Serail a delegation of the economic bodies in Lebanon, headed by former Minister Mohammad Choucair.

During the meeting, Choucair congratulated Mikati on the formation of the government, wishing him success in his new mission.

On the other hand, Mikati chaired a meeting to continue ration card discussions, in the presence of Deputy Prime Minister Saade Chami, Social Affairs Minister, Hector Hajjar, Trade and Economy Minister, Amin Salam, Finance Minister, Youssef Al-Khalil, MP Nicolas Nahhas, Secretary General of the Council of Ministers Mahmoud Makkieh, and Mikati’s Office Director Jamal Karim.

Mikati also met with Minister of Foreign Affairs and Emigrants, Abdallah Bou Habib, over relevant Ministry affairs.

Mikati later received MEA Board Chairman Mohammed El-Hout, with talks touching on the situation of the company and future development plans.
